Nordisk Renting acquires SAS' properties in Frosundavik for just over SEK 1,100m


STOCKHOLM, Sweden, Nov. 11, 2003 (PRIMEZONE) -- Nordisk Renting is acquiring Scandinavian Airlines' headquarters in Frosundavik, just north of Stockholm city, for just over SEK 1,100m. At the same time, SAS is signing a long-term leasing contract with Nordisk Renting.

The headquarters encompass a total area of 57,000 square metres, mainly comprising office space with glazed facades. The property consists of seven interlinked and two free-standing buildings. The seven main buildings surround an atrium housing common facilities such as the reception lobby, conference premises, shops and restaurants. In conjunction with the sale, SAS is concentrating its Stockholm-based operations into the property, thereby making it the airline's corporate head office for the Nordic region. The contract entitles SAS at certain points and on pre-determined terms to acquire the property or designate another buyer.

"The sale is part of the SAS Group's focus on its core business," says Jorgen Lindegaard, CEO of SAS. "We are releasing capital that can partly be used in airline operations, while at the same time allowing a professional real estate owner to acquire the office properties. The leasing contract means that SAS will continue to have a presence in Frosundavik in the future."

SAS AB is the Nordic region's largest publicly listed airline and travel group, and the fourth largest airline group in Europe in terms of passenger numbers and income.

Nordisk Renting already owns hotel properties with Rezidor SAS Hospitality as the tenant and hotel operator, along with shares in several airport-related properties in Norway, Denmark and Sweden with SAS as the tenant.

"It is very stimulating to expand our co-operation and in this way help SAS strengthen its position in the long term as northern Europe's leading airline group," says Reinhold Geijer, CEO of Nordisk Renting AB. "Moreover, the headquarters in Frosundavik have an attractive location in Solna, right on the approach to Stockholm city near the E4 European Highway, with direct connections to Stockholm Arlanda airport."

The property sale is dependent on the necessary approval from the authorities.
